Rebodis took part in “Healthy Everyday Life for Vulnerable Communities Through Technology,” a community outreach program organized by the Department of Mechanical Engineering at Seoul National University.


The event invited seniors from Gwanak-gu and their families to explore their current physical condition and envision a healthier future through technology. Around 40 seniors attended the event through prior registration, making it a meaningful and engaging gathering.


At the event, Rebodis hosted a hands-on experience with its robotic knee assist device. Through direct interaction and guided trials, seniors were able to experience robotic technology not as an unfamiliar machine, but as a reliable assistant that supports their own bodies.


Rebodis believes that narrowing the gap between research and the real world, between technology and people, is a core responsibility of a technology company.


By listening closely to voices from the field, we will continue to develop warm, human-centered technology that truly integrates into everyday life.
